To help people track their gut health and hydration remotely, they’ve released Dekoda, a toilet camera that can analyze bowel movements. This groundbreaking smart device features toilet analysis technology to provide users with essential insights into their health and wellness. It’s meant to help people feel more in control of their health.
The Dekoda camera has high-tech sensors that aim directly at the toilet bowl. This design minimizes the privacy issues while still taking very clear images of the waste. By interpreting these images, Dekoda provides real-time information about gut health, hydration status, and even the early detection of blood. This new capability has the potential to serve as a personal early warning system. It flags them for potential health issues that require medical attention.
